dYdX is a decentralised exchange focused on perpetual futures trading. Unlike most DEXes which use AMMs, dYdX runs an on-chain order book on its own dYdX Chain (Cosmos SDK). Offers up to 20× leverage on 50+ markets with low fees.
Pros
- Order book execution (not AMM slippage)
- 50+ perp markets with up to 20× leverage
- No KYC, self-custodial via wallet signing
- Trading fees competitive with centralised exchanges
Cons
- Steeper learning curve than AMM DEXes
- No spot trading — perpetuals only
- Bridging to dYdX Chain adds friction
Fees
Maker fee: 0.02%, Taker: 0.05% standard. Volume-based discounts down to 0% maker / 0.025% taker.
Regulation
dYdX Trading Inc. ceased serving US persons in 2022. The dYdX Chain is fully decentralised, open-source software with no central operator.
